    The Sequoia wheelbase is 122 inches.
    The RCSB wheelbase is 126.8 inches.
    When I was doing the T-case swap on my truck, I looked into this to determine if I could use the Sequoia rear driveshaft.

    With the Eibach Stage 1 kit that @phabej is running, I wouldn’t recommend a front sway bar delete. Bilsteins you would be ok, but I found the Eibachs to be pretty loose in the corners - both Stage 1 and Stage 2, but moreso stage 1, even on a stock vehicle set at stock height. Just my opinion.
